Just dropped off our KDX bikes to the suspension shop. My son's is sn 03, and is all stock suspension. He is 18, 6'-2" and weighs about 240 plus gear. We are novice/intermediate riders. Will not be doing any Motocross stuff. Just riding trails and Enduros. What springs should I tell the shop to order? My son likes a soft to medium ride.

I weigh about 170 pounds, and I'm 5'-9". My 97 KDX has KX 125 front forks from a 1995. Stock rear spring. Do I need to change my Springs? I really don't want to spend the money on springs for my bike. I think it's pretty close to what it should be. I like a soft ride. I've only ridden the bike about an hour. It seems okay, but I probably wouldn't know if it was wrong! :-)

Re: What F&R springs do I need?

Post by KDXGarage »

5.4 or 5.6 and .48 (stiffest they make) for the son's bike

leave it stock on yours

But I would surely let them make the call.
